> When trying to execute radlogin I keep getting this error message:
> 
> radlogin[13740]: rc_own_ipaddress: couldn't get own IP address
> 
> I'm stumped, the hostname and ip address both resolve via nslookup and
> dig
> The radiusclient package was built using the ports collection.
> 
> The system in question is running the following:
> 
> FreeBSD 5.0-RELEASE #0: Fri Jan 17 20:03:38 GMT 2003
> root at numenor.btc.adaptec.com:/usr/obj/usr/src/sys/GENERIC sparc64
> 
> Any ideas how to correct this problem?

Make sure you've got the loopback address (127.0.0.1 for IPv4) in your /etc/hosts.
